Infographic: The Value of a Link in 2012

It can be difficult to dominate the SERPS, and a balancing act choosing how best to prioritize your search engine optimization efforts. In terms of off-page optimization, building quality links is one of the best ways to improve your rankings and increase your organic traffic. But just what is a good or ‘quality’ link? Is it the page-level, domain level, or something other than pagerank? With Google’s recent aggressive deindexation of link networks and other backlink farms, along with , this question is more pertinent than ever if you wish to adhere to best practice and gain (and keep) sustainable rankings.

Hundreds of SEO professionals were interviewed for the following infographic, which details the prevailing opinions and practices in the industry – and more importantly, how they might value a potential link partner or prospect.
